> Dear colleagues,
>
>
> It is time to elect a new Co-coordinator for the Caucus, to replace
> Analía who has already completed her two-year term, and to work with
> me (Arsene). As you know, the IGC is operating with two volunteers
> called “Co-coordinators”.
>
>
> I would like to send my apologies for the time it took me to quick
> start this process; as you know, we have been busy with migrating our
> server but also I informed that I will be launching this once we have
> submitted our workshop proposal to the upcoming IGF (which we did
> today). This is an usual process and I beg you to bear with me. You
> will remember I did launch this call while we were still working on
> the server but so many of you only saw it later on when the system was
> restored back.
>
>
> We invite members of the IGC to nominate candidates (please check with
> them first about their willingness to serve), or to nominate
> themselves as Co-coordinator to serve for 2 years, from 2017-2019. All
> you need to do is to send TO THE LIST your statement of interest (in
> the body of an email and attached in a .doc file) with the following
> elements:
>
> -          Your full name
>
> -          Your country of origin and of residence
>
> -          Anything we need to know about your work/involvement with
> IGC/IGF/Civil Society activities. (200 words max)
>
> -          Why do you think you can be a good Co-coordinator for the
> IGC? (Max 200 words)
>
> -          What’s your vision for the IGC during your term if elected?
> Pick up to 3 current issues we face in the group that you will
> consider as priority during your first year. (Max 200 words)
>
>
> The nomination period will be open until midnight UTC on May 10th,
> 2017. After this date, we will circulate a resume of candidate's
> profiles and enable a voting link to all IGC members in order to elect
> our new co-coordinator.
